Readers have alerted the News to a 'hazardous' road works near the old Largs Academy.
Sharon Caldwell said: "The temporary traffic lights in Flatt Road are next to no street lights.
"It is not well lit and the roadworks and therefore hazardous as traffic is trying to navigate in the dark.
"Motorists can't see what is happening, and I certainly can't."
A new power line is being installed to the new affordable housing that is being built in the area.
A spokeswoman for Scottish Power said that they had looked into the situation: "Service has been restored to the street lighting, but there still seems to be a problem which isn't associated to the roadworks. The council are checking but it would seem to be a problem at their end." North Ayrshire Council had earlier re-directed the 'News' to Scottish Power.
